1. Metrics Monitoring

Earlier than you’ll be able to enhance something, you need to measure it — and CX is not any exception. Constructing metrics can also be a great way to determine belief together with your stakeholders. 

For CX particularly, some frequent metrics embrace:

  • SLA (Service Stage Settlement): That is the dedication or goal for a way rapidly the client help workforce responds to buyer contacts. For instance, “reply to all chats inside 3 minutes.” It’s important to watch whether or not the workforce at all times complies with the SLA. It’s usually measured as the share of help interactions that meet this aim. 
  • TTR (Time to Decision): SLA cares about whether or not every interplay was executed in a well timed method, whereas TTR measures the entire time it takes to resolve a help ticket — together with all of the forwards and backwards. Think about you, as a consumer, reached out to buyer help by way of electronic mail for a product query. They responded rapidly each time you messaged them, however not one of the replies really solved the query. On this case, SLA would look good, however TTR could be lengthy. That’s why we’d like each to finish the story.
  • FCR (First Contact Decision): Ideally, the client can be supplied with what precisely they’re on the lookout for within the very first dialog. Subsequently, FCR is designed to measure the share of help tickets which can be resolved with no need follow-ups. Naturally, a low FCR is correlated with a excessive TTR.
  • CSAT (Buyer Satisfaction Rating): The above metrics are all inner measures of how rapidly we get again to our clients and clear up the problems, whereas CSAT is a direct exterior measure of how happy clients are with the help they obtained. It’s typically captured by way of a survey after a help ticket is resolved, with a query like “How happy had been you with the help you obtained?” (rating 1 to five). 
  • Contact Charge: We care in regards to the high quality of the service, however it’s equally essential to know what number of help instances are generated. A good way to normalize the case quantity is to calculate the Contact Charge because the variety of instances / variety of lively clients. This tells us how typically clients encounter points and need assistance, so it is usually a measure of product friction. 

In fact, there are numerous extra metrics we have now constructed for the CX workforce, however the above metrics ought to offer you a great first glimpse into what knowledge issues to the CX workforce. They, after all, are organized and introduced in dashboards so the workforce can monitor the efficiency and dive into sure case varieties, groups, or buyer segments. At my firm, the information workforce additionally co-hosts a weekly metrics overview assembly to identify traits, floor insights, and drive discussions. 

Now that we have now all these metrics, how we could make the most of them to drive modifications? That’s the place the true energy of information science is available in. See the next use instances. 

2. Workforce Administration

Every buyer help interplay leads to labor prices in addition to expertise prices, overhead prices, and different operational prices that include it. Subsequently, it’s important to precisely monitor capability and forecast future help demand for staffing and planning.

The info workforce can present numerous worth right here:

  • Forecasting contact quantity: This can be a complicated however high-impact job. It first requires cross-functional collaboration to get the appropriate assumption of buyer progress projections and alter the contact fee expectation given product launches and enhancements. Then, knowledge scientists can make the most of knowledge toolkits like time sequence fashions to bake in all of the assumptions and predict the help case quantity. 
  • Capability planning: As soon as we get a great prediction of contact quantity, the following query is what number of help brokers we might want to preserve a great degree of service. This requires state of affairs simulation of agent efficiency and availability, and optimization of the agent shift schedules to make sure we meet SLAs with out overstaffing.   

3. Course of Enhancements

Information just isn’t solely useful to trace the workforce efficiency, however it might additionally drive actual course of enhancements. Simply to provide you a number of examples that I’ve seen:

  • TTR evaluation: TTR is only a random giant quantity with out making sense of it. The info workforce can analyze TTR to determine drivers of lengthy decision time and use that to tell course of enhancements. For instance, if the onboarding-related instances typically take an extended time with many back-and-forths, this might suggest that the CX workforce wants extra coaching concerning the present onboarding course of, or the onboarding stream is over-complicated, so clients continuously discover it complicated. If the instances coming from electronic mail normally have a very long time to decision with a low CSAT, possibly we must always allocate extra assets to reply the e-mail queue to hurry up the responses, or present higher tooling help to assist brokers draft their emails. 
  • Help tiering technique: Not all clients are of equal worth to a enterprise. Subsequently, a typical follow is to create help tiers amongst clients and prioritize the contacts from top-tier clients. The info workforce can assist give you the tiering system based mostly on buyer worth and monitor the effectiveness over time.
  • A/B testing of help stream: The place ought to we put the stay chat button? Methods to make the help middle extra discoverable for purchasers? Is a sure auto-reply electronic mail format higher than one other? A/B testing technique helps us reply these help stream design questions. 
  • Self-service enhancements: The best world of buyer help is not any human help wanted 🙂 Although that is practically inconceivable to succeed in, the information workforce can assist to get nearer. For instance, we checked out what sort of questions customers didn’t resolve by way of the assistance middle. This informs what new subjects ought to be added to the assistance articles and the way the assistance middle search perform ought to be improved. 
  • Chatbot enhancements: Chatbot is a typical instrument to reply clients’ questions with out routing to actual brokers. Particularly on this AI period, we have now seen vital enhancements in chatbot high quality and availability. Our knowledge workforce has performed a important function in two rounds of chatbot vendor analysis with the CX workforce — establishing the information pipeline, A/B testing of various chatbot choices, evaluating chatbot efficiency, figuring out the low-performing contact classes, and serving to fine-tune the bots to realize a greater chatbot containment fee. 

4. Buyer Suggestions Evaluation

Final however not least, help contacts generate a large amount of textual content knowledge — they arrive instantly from the purchasers and can be utilized to know buyer ache factors and product gaps. 

  • Case categorization: Help instances could be categorized manually by the CX workforce or with a rule-based framework, however the knowledge workforce can assist to automate this step, particularly with AI’s energy at the moment. With easy immediate engineering, most LLMs at the moment can categorize every case based mostly in your product context with respectable accuracy. 
  • Textual content evaluation: Besides from categorization, AI can take the entire case transcripts to summarize and determine the client ache factors. My workforce collaborated with the engineers to construct an inner AI product referred to as “Voice of the Clients” that processes all case particulars by LLM and surfaces the most typical buyer complaints in every product space. This can be a good alternative to convey CX insights to the entire firm and shut the suggestions loop with product and advertising. We’ve seen it getting used actively in product roadmapping.
